    Quoted from tonedef131:

    I've never shipped a pin before, who do you use and how do you get it quoted?

    Some shipping companies like Forward Air offer very reasonable shipping quotes if you are willing to accept insurance at $1/pound and you are able to pallet or crate the game (as a seller) and are willing to pick it up at a terminal (if you are the buyer).

    Shipping a pinball machine is not as scary as some believe. I have shipped over 100 games, both as a buyer and seller, since I started collecting. In my experience, properly prepping the game for shipping helps lessen the risk of damage. It does not eliminate the risk, but it does offer a layer of protection.

    Marcus

    freightquote.com works but will have limited terminals they use at any given time.

    FedEx does LTL fright for a good price in most cases. Wrap and strap on end to a smaller foot print pallet as that is what matters for their metric on cost.

    Should be ~$250 in most cases.
